Brownian Motion


Brownian Motion is the random motion of particles suspended in a fluid (a liquid or a gas) resulting from their collision with the fast-moving molecules in the fluid. In Data Science, Brownian Motion is used as a mathematical model for various phenomena, such as stock prices, bacterial movement, and financial markets. It is also used in Monte Carlo simulations to model the behavior of complex systems. Brownian Motion is a stochastic process, meaning that it is a random process that evolves over time. It is characterized by its mean and variance, which describe the average behavior of the particles over time. The mean of Brownian Motion is zero, and its variance is proportional to the time elapsed. This means that the longer the time, the more spread out the particles become.
